OpenCode Review

Open source AI coding agent for developers to write code in terminal, IDE, or desktop.

Chat Frontends & Clients

Verdict

OpenCode is a versatile AI coding agent that offers a range of features, including multi-session support and integration with various LLM providers. However, its open-source nature may require more technical expertise to fully utilize. With a large community of contributors and users, OpenCode has established itself as a trusted tool for developers.

Best for

Developers who need an AI-powered coding assistant with flexibility and customization options.
